Dadapuram Population - Viluppuram, Tamil Nadu

Dadapuram is a large village located in Tindivanam Taluka of Viluppuram district, Tamil Nadu with total 661 families residing. The Dadapuram village has population of 2723 of which 1330 are males while 1393 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Dadapuram village population of children with age 0-6 is 276 which makes up 10.14 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Dadapuram village is 1047 which is higher than Tamil Nadu state average of 996. Child Sex Ratio for the Dadapuram as per census is 1123, higher than Tamil Nadu average of 943.

Dadapuram village has lower literacy rate compared to Tamil Nadu. In 2011, literacy rate of Dadapuram village was 70.54 % compared to 80.09 % of Tamil Nadu. In Dadapuram Male literacy stands at 79.08 % while female literacy rate was 62.31 %.

Caste Factor

Dadapuram village of Viluppuram has substantial population of Schedule Caste.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 29.31 % of total population in Dadapuram village. The village Dadapuram curr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Dadapuram village out of total population, 1321 were engaged in work activities. 70.40 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 29.60 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 1321 workers engaged in Main Work, 543 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 238 were Agricultural labourer.
